Por qué la gestión de las integraciones de clientes a escala rompe los modelos de entrega tradicionales
A medida que las agencias y los integradores de sistemas amplían su base de clientes, la forma en que la mayoría de las empresas crean integraciones comienza a perjudicarles. Cada entorno se crea por separado, se mantiene por separado y se monitorea por separado. Lo que parece manejable con cinco clientes se convierte en algo realmente difícil con veinte.
Las compilaciones punto a punto personalizadas no producen activos reutilizables. Producen dependencias aisladas. Cuando un proveedor actualiza su API, el script personalizado creado para ese cliente deja de funcionar. Un desarrollador tiene que cambiar de contexto a ese entorno, localizar la lógica no documentada y corregirla debido a la presión del tiempo. Multiplique esa cantidad en una cartera en crecimiento y el mantenimiento consumirá la capacidad que debería destinarse a las nuevas tareas de entrega.
También hay un problema de conocimiento. Un flujo de trabajo bien estructurado creado para un cliente no se puede transferir fácilmente a otro si ambos entornos están completamente aislados. El mismo problema se resuelve desde cero y el costo se absorbe con el margen del proyecto.
El resultado se muestra de tres maneras predecibles:
- La carga de trabajo de soporte aumenta a medida que cada integración interrumpida requiere un diagnóstico individual
- Los plazos de entrega se extienden porque no hay una base reutilizable desde la que empezar
- Los márgenes de los servicios gestionados se reducen a medida que la supervisión de entornos aislados se vuelve cada vez más cara
Estos son problemas estructurales que la contratación de más desarrolladores no soluciona.
Qué ofrece una plataforma de integración multicliente
Una plataforma de integración multicliente es una solución centralizada diseñada para los proveedores de servicios que administran múltiples entornos de clientes distintos. En lugar de mantener herramientas independientes o una base de código separada por cliente, el equipo de entrega opera desde una interfaz unificada.
La plataforma crea entornos aislados y particionados para cada cliente dentro del hub central. El enrutamiento de datos, las credenciales de API, la lógica de transformación y las reglas empresariales dependen del entorno de cada cliente. Un consultor que trabaja en el espacio de un cliente no puede afectar a los flujos de datos de otro cliente. Cada entorno se gobierna de forma independiente, pero es visible de forma colectiva desde la misma capa administrativa.
Esta estructura brinda a las agencias una visibilidad completa de la cartera desde un solo lugar, combinada con el aislamiento de seguridad que requiere cada entorno de cliente. También se encarga de la traducción automática de los formatos de datos, convirtiendo los datos de origen en la estructura que el sistema de destino requiere durante el enrutamiento, lo que elimina la sobrecarga de mapeo manual que, por lo general, consume tiempo de los consultores en cada nueva contratación.
Los beneficios operativos que se derivan
Entrega más rápida a través de plantillas reutilizables
Un flujo de trabajo creado correctamente para un cliente puede duplicarse en un nuevo entorno de cliente y ajustarse a sus mapeos de campo y lógica empresarial específicos. No es necesario reconstruir la arquitectura de conexión subyacente cada vez. Esto reduce el tiempo que transcurre entre el inicio del proyecto y la integración funcional, lo que repercute tanto en la satisfacción del cliente como en el número de proyectos que el equipo puede ejecutar en paralelo.
Reducción de los gastos generales de mantenimiento
Cuando las integraciones se basan en conectores estandarizados dentro de una plataforma gobernada en lugar de en código personalizado, la carga de mantenimiento cambia. Si un proveedor de software actualiza su API, la plataforma actualiza el conector. Las conexiones permanecen estables sin requerir la intervención de emergencia del desarrollador en las bases de código de los clientes individuales.
Un modelo de servicios gestionados viable
Ofrecer la gestión de la integración como un servicio recurrente es difícil de ofrecer de forma rentable cuando el entorno de cada cliente requiere una supervisión individual. Una plataforma centralizada cambia esta situación. El equipo de soporte supervisa el estado de salud, el uso de las API y los registros de errores en todos los entornos de los clientes de forma simultánea desde un panel de control. Los problemas surgen y se resuelven antes de que los clientes se den cuenta de ellos, lo que constituye la base operativa de una oferta de servicios gestionados fiable.








